Flare has recently issued two new official documents, one of which contains a significant announcement targeting individuals who have relocated their governance votes to alternative addresses.

This announcement comes in conjunction with an important update to the Flare Portal, designed to safeguard the majority of token holders from the alterations.

Under the updated system, the number of votes attributed to an address will be determined by a combination of the WFLR (Wrapped Flare) holdings and the staked funds on the P-chain at a specific block.

Consequently, staking activities will not diminish one's ability to participate in governance. It's worth noting that these enhancements will affect individuals who have previously transferred their votes to different addresses or from their Personal Delegation Account (PDA).

If this applies to you, navigate to the Flare Portal's voting page where you can easily safeguard your active voice by clicking the "Transfer Votes" button.

Developers and enterprises who want to gain access to Flare nodes and leverage its technology now have three primary avenues to access Flare nodes. First, the Flare Foundation provides a free public API with rate limits suitable for basic functions.

Second, Node-as-a-Service companies offer APIs with higher bandwidth options and tiered payment levels, making it more accessible. The Flare API Portal, backed by the Flare Labs team, provides unparalleled support and reliability. The API Portal seamlessly integrates with the Google Cloud Marketplace, ensuring a secure and user-friendly experience for accessing Flare nodes within your current cloud setup.

Moreover, it distinguishes itself as the sole provider of Blockchain Explorer APIs for Flare networks, boosting its usefulness and establishing it as an all-encompassing solution for developers and enterprises.

If infrastructure setup is not your preference, Flare collaborates with Node-as-a-Service partners, such as Ankr for global multi-chain tools, NOWNodes for affordable shared RPC nodes, and Blockdaemon, connecting institutions and developers to major networks.

Third, you have the option to run your own node, either using Docker from DockerHub, following Flare’s documentation instructions, or directly from the GitHub code repository. Each method offers unique advantages and access to Flare's decentralized oracles optimized for decentralized data acquisition.

Arkham Intel

CEO Miguel suggests that the core objective of Arkham Intel is to enhance transparency and knowledge within blockchain technology. To achieve this, they have developed a technology solution that enables users to access information about the owners of blockchain wallets.

There are two main ways Arkham is used: The first is for end users primarily using a point and click UI/UX whereby they do their research and leave. The second is for the more sophisticated developers, who access it for raw data which they can manipulate, produce their custom dashboard, or analyze different metrics.

Bridge integration with Arkham was mentioned. Currently, there is no support for bridges, but it's planned for the future, with the current focus on DeFi support. API access to historical data for developers was highlighted where developers can apply for access to leverage Arkham Intel technology. Wallets can be labeled for transparency using either a manual team-based approach or an automated algorithmic method when integrating new blockchains into Arkham.

Flarescan

Flarescan acts as a unified explorer, offering users the ability to view transactions on both Flare and Songbird networks, eliminating fragmented information. This unified explorer enhances the user experience, making it easier for developers and users, especially those testing applications, to access contract details and source codes for all chains supported on Flare.

Giacomo expressed excitement about developing Flarescan, emphasizing their expertise in Avalanche technology. Flarescan specializes in indexing and displaying P-chain data, including staking and validator information. Their commitment is to expand the functionalities of Flare, both on the EVM and staking aspects. Giacomo shares that "a lot of P chain information will be running from November," and he adds, "that is when public staking will be live on Flare."

Flarescan will be supporting validator statistics and signal provider statistics. Validator statistics, including revamped staking and p-chain data, will be available from December Sneak peeks for Flarescan. In the pipeline is full support for the p-chain, allowing browsing of all p-chain blocks, access to staking data, historical data, and uptime. Expected rollout from November to December. Following this, Flarescan also aims to deploy support for FLR domain names. Custom features for bridges will also be introduced, and other specific Flare features.

Community Q&A

Towards the end of the call, the community had the opportunity to pose questions, and CEO of Flare Network, Hugo Philion, shared insightful perspectives on the advantages of staking versus delegating. Hugo explained that staking brings about higher yields because it represents a pivotal contribution to the network. In this process, users essentially commit their funds, bearing the risk of not earning to ensure the network's security.

He emphasized the importance of staking, highlighting Flare's mission to be the network for data and ensure the provision of top-quality data through FTSOs and future web connectors. The overarching goal is to make the network useful for applications, developers, and users. Another inquiry pertained to the real-world utility of Flare. In response, Hugo discussed the realm of machine learning, highlighting the growing demand in the market.

He pointed out a challenge where many companies, particularly small to medium-sized ones, grapple with adopting or utilizing machine learning due to the cost and scarcity of data science expertise.

Hugo revealed that he has been actively collaborating with external partners to devise a solution, aiming to establish a marketplace for machine learning engineers. The vision entails the ability to provide your backlog of data to an engineer who can fine-tune and craft a tailored, optimized machine learning model for your specific company, akin to an ChatGPT-like service.

Payments for these services can be executed through the blockchain, and the integrity of the work can be validated by attesting the data from the machine learning model onto the blockchain via web connectors. Payment release would be contingent upon demonstrating a substantial improvement in the machine learning model's performance.

Partnerships

Flare has joined forces with Web3Auth, a leading Wallet-as-a-Service (WaaS) provider, with the goal of enhancing the user experience for both mainstream and crypto-savvy users.

This collaboration simplifies access to Web 3 apps by introducing email and social logins, eliminating the necessity for intricate seed phrases. Importantly, Web3Auth preserves non-custodial wallet management, ensuring user control and privacy in line with blockchain principles.

Users can now enjoy a more user-friendly 'web2.5 experience', akin to popular platforms such as Google, Apple, Telegram, and more, ensuring seamless access to Flare's dApps. Developers can seamlessly integrate the Web3Auth Software Development Kit (SDK) in under 8 minutes, enabling their users to establish secure, non-custodial wallets in seconds.

This empowers users to maintain complete control and ownership of their cryptographic wallets, reinforcing the core principles of privacy and security within blockchain technology.

FlareBuilders

FlareBuilders has embarked on a new endeavor by creating a Flare Validator Tracker, which displays essential information such as the Validator's name, node ID, stake amount, fees, uptime, and more. This tool is crucial as we approach the staking phase.
